Regulatory Developments Across Regions
Authorities in Malta and Australia have released updated guidelines that address player verification processes and data protection standards, while Canadian provincial regulators have introduced measures focused on responsible gaming tools that must appear in all licensed applications. Research indicates these changes coincide with a rise in cross-border play, and figures reveal that operators adapting their systems to meet multiple regional standards see expanded user bases. Experts have observed that such adaptations often include real-time identity checks and spending limit features, which align with broader industry efforts to standardize safety protocols without disrupting gameplay flow.

Security and Compliance Indicators
Encryption standards and third-party audits serve as baseline expectations, and evidence from regulatory filings demonstrates that platforms publishing regular reports on random number generator testing maintain stronger reputations among users. Analysts have documented that integration of multi-factor authentication alongside account monitoring tools reduces reported incidents of unauthorized access. Data from various oversight bodies shows continued emphasis on these elements as markets expand into new geographic areas during 2026.
